History of St. Croix Montessori School


St. Croix Montessori School (SCMS) was opened thirty years ago with a vision to nurture the mind and spirit of the three-year-old son of its founders. Their interest in research that had been conducted on brain development of young children led them to learn more about Maria Montessori’s philosophy and to open a school in Hudson, WI, which was named Hudson’s Children’s House and More.

 

In 1994 a larger space was found in Stillwater which became the home school’s home. In 1999, the adjacent property known as “The Ames Farm “was purchased, giving children opportunities to care for chickens and alpacas. Over the years, our menagerie of farm animals has grown, adding mini donkeys and goats to the children’s experience.

Heads of School, excellent staff, dedicated board members, and fantastic family volunteers helped shape the school into what it is today. These individuals volunteered on projects which included the pavilion construction, the farmhouse remodel, playground, and many interior updates.

 

SCMS’s journey has been dedicated to children, and our commitment to AMI Accredited Montessori Education has been unwavering. Our guiding Montessori principles and values have always been strong and true, allowing us to evolve into more than just a school but also a place where lifelong friendships are made, talents are shared, and memories created.

 

Valerie Olson is the current AMI Montessori trained Head of School. All teachers at St. Croix Montessori School have completed graduate level training through Association Montessori Internationale (AMI), which is the international organization that upholds the highest standard in Montessori teacher training.
